Output 299abf1b173504ef94d96d56336d66f6988aff7763988d3622c7524fb5ec968c:0

value
522850
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a367cd095a9959ce58654a2fe12f0ae9e9cbd2e8 OP_EQUAL
address
3Gb2R2WEgwa7MC7A1WHkR7mWxwg3e7zhae
transaction
299abf1b173504ef94d96d56336d66f6988aff7763988d3622c7524fb5ec968c
confirmations
396034
spent
true